The HP ENVY 5530 e-All-In-One Printer series as well as various HP DeskJet 27xxe All-In-One Printer models are listed in About AirPrint - Apple Support.


You may want to try a full power-cycle sequence (including the router, in this order, with these waiting times)?

Power off the Wi-Fi router, the printers, the iPhone, and all other devices/computers. Wait two to three minutes. Power on the router. Wait two to three minutes. Power on the printers. Wait a minute or two. Power on the iPhone. Finally, power on all other devices/computers.


Are you using VPN on the iPhone?


Have you checked whether the printers have been updated to the latest firmware versions?
